Ligi Yatu November
On Saturday there was a great day in Petauke! 188 kids participated in this months Ligi Yatu. The rainseason is appoaching so we used the occation to prepare the participants with educational sessions about personal hygiene to reduce the risk of Cholera disease. Ligi Yatu September
Now the schools are up and running again and we have conducted this semesters first Ligi Yatu. This month the topic was peer pressure. Rural Changers educated the 125 participants in what peer pressure is and how to avoid being victims. While some of the teams where in session, others played their games.
